梧 combines the radical 木 (tree) with 吾 (wú), which serves as a phonetic component. It refers to the parasol tree (Firmiana simplex), whose broad leaves resemble a parasol.

Frequently Asked Questions about 梧

梧 is made of two parts: the left radical 木 (tree) and the right component 吾 (wú, which gives the sound). The 木 radical shows that 梧 is a type of tree, specifically the parasol tree. The right side 吾 is phonetic and does not contribute to the meaning.
